A West Side. woman sued Cén-| {tral Baptist Seminary for $10,000 today because she was refused al ldiploma after completing a four-| year course, | Mrs. Rosie Campbell, 2616 Ethel | St., , complained in a Superior |C ourt 4 suit She finished her| studtes last May but was refused a Bachelor of Theology degree. Also, she said, she attended four summer sessions, Her attorney said Mrs. Campbell undertook the instruction to
